Hibs' potential play-off opponents emerge but face battle to keep key forward
Gent hold the aces after prevailing in Sweden
Hibs are on course to meet Belgian opposition in the play-off round of the Conference League should they finish the job against KF Shkendija next week.
That is because Gent earned an important 1-0 win away at IFK Goteborg in the first leg of their third qualifying round in Sweden. The winner of that tie is due to face Hibs or Shkendija next.
While Hibs required a stoppage-time winner from defender Warren O’Hora to overcome the North Macedonians in Edinburgh, Gent were far more convincing in their performance at the Galma Ullevi in Gothenburg.
In front of a crowd of just over 15,000, Gent took the lead on stroke of half time through young Ivorian forward Hyllarion Goore after dominating the opening 45 minutes.
IFK Goteborg rallied after the break, but were unable to find a leveller and now have it all to do when they travel to Gent’s Planet Group Arena next Thursday.
However, the Belgians may be without one of their forwards for that match after it emerged that their English striker Max Dean is coveted by Bolton Wanderers.
It has been reported that the English Championship outfit have tabled a bid in the region of £1 million for the 22-year-old, which was rejected by the Gent hierarchy.
Dean has scored 20 goals in 53 appearances for Gent over the past two seasons and value the ex-MK Dons man much higher. However, Wanderers are expected to up their offer in the coming days. Dean was an unused substitute in Sweden.
Ahead of next Thursday’s return leg in Belgium, IFK Goteborg have an Allsvenskan match against Kalmar at home, while Gent kick off their Jupiler Pro League campaign at home to KV Mechelen. Both matches are on Sunday.
